BIOGRAPHY: 

Kathleen Finlay is a fine art photographer who has been exhibiting her work for over 35 years in Canada and Internationally. Since 2016, Kathleen has returned to painting, specializing in large scale acrylic paintings on wood panel while continuing her photography work. As the founder and organizer of The Soulfood from 2018 to 2022, Kathleen created a collective of rotating artists invited to participate in events organized in different cities in Ontario and Québec.

artistic approach: 

Kathleen Finlay’s work explores the purity in nature contrasting with human interaction and man-made structures. Kathleen is fascinated with symbols that remind us that life is fleeting and transient. In contrast to a culture where abundance drowns the senses, these images take us back to the purity and truth found in nature. The austerity of her photographic landscapes is dotted with traces of our passage and illustrate the idea that nature is immense and that our part in it is ultimately insignificant. Her paintings explore architectural, linear and geometric patterns both human-made and observed in the natural world.
